Table of Contents
CONTENTS: Cassette 1: Three landscapes (approx. 14 min.). Choreography: Ze'eva Cohen. Part III is an improvisation. Music: Alan Hovhaness (Part I), John Cage (Part II), Ali Akbar Khan (Part III). -- One (approx. 10 min.). Choreography: Richard Gibson. Music: Maurice Ravel. -- Cassette 2: Listen II (approx. 9 min.). Choreography: Cohen. Music: George Crumb. -- 32 variations in C minor (approx. 11 min.). Choreography: James Waring. Music: Ludwig Van Beethoven. Pianist: Patricia DeVore. -- Countdown (approx. 8 min.). Choreography: Rudy Perez. Music: "Songs of the Auvergne," arr. by Canteloube. According to a note on label, this version not at performance level. -- Cassette 3: Countdown [repeated in full] (approx. 8 min.). Same credits as above.

Notes
Venue: Videotaped at American Theatre Laboratory, New York, in April 1977. Program presented by Dance Theater Workshop in March 1977.
